  • SharePoint Commerce Services

    Commerce Server 2009 R2 provides a rich, out-of-the-box shopping Web site that is a collection of over 30 Web Parts and controls that you can combine and deploy on a SharePoint site to provide a full e-commerce retail-shopping site for your shoppers.
